The first of these external assurance reviews were published in 2021.2021 Theand reviews provided a detailed assessment of each authority’s financial position and financial management, with clear recommendations on where the authority needs to take action to improve. In the case of 3 authorities (Peterborough, Slough and Wirral), the external assurance reviews looked at both their financial position and wider governance arrangements, focusing on the authorities’ ability to deliver a plan for financial sustainability with policies and procedures in place to ensure robust decision making and accountability.
The capitalisation directions published above relate to support for the financial years 2020-21 and 2021-22. As indicated below, a small number of authorities who originally requested additional financial support for 2021-22 withdrewhave since withdrawn their requests where their financial position and pressures have changed. In all cases,cases the government has set a clear expectation that the authorities respond effectively to the challenges and recommendations highlighted in the external assurance reviews, and provide regular updates to the government on progress.
